API 3124 too much gain

When close mic'ing toms with MD421's through an API 3124, and the pad engaged, I'm still getting pretty high levels. Is there something I'm doing wrong?

if you search, you'll see this very topic has been brought up. but to save you time, look into getting line attenuators for the outputs - A Designs ATTY comes recommended. like giving the 3124 master volumes- the unit sounds nice in the red
